Lets compare vitamin content per 1 pound of Red Kidney Beans vs Hemp Seeds:
- 1 pound of Red Kidney Beans has 3.6 times more Vitamin B9 and 9 times more Vitamin C than Hemp Seeds.
- While 1 lb of Hulled Hemp Seeds contains 2.1 times more Vitamin B1, 1.3 times more Vitamin B2, 4.4 times more Vitamin B3, 1.5 times more Vitamin B6 and 3.8 times more Vitamin E than Raw Red Kidney Beans.
- Both Red Kidney Beans and Hemp Seeds provide similar amounts of Vitamin K per one pound.
- 1 pound of Red Kidney Beans have insufficient amounts of Vitamin E
- 1 pound of Hemp Seeds have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
- Both Raw Red Kidney Beans as well as Hulled Hemp Seeds have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in one pound.
Comparing minerals per 1 pound for Red Kidney Beans vs Hemp Seeds:
- 1 lb of Hulled Hemp Seeds contains 2.3 times more Copper, 5.1 times more Magnesium, 6.8 times more Manganese, 4.1 times more Phosphorus, 8.1 times more Selenium and 3.5 times more Zinc than Raw Red Kidney Beans.
- Both Red Kidney Beans and Hemp Seeds contain similar levels of Calcium, Iron and Potassium per one pound.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 pound:
- 1 pound of Red Kidney Beans has 7.1 times more Carbohydrate, 1.4 times more Sugars and 3.8 times more Fiber than Hemp Seeds.
- While 1 lb of Hulled Hemp Seeds contains 1.6 times more Energy, 46 times more Fat, 29.9 times more Saturated Fat, 28 times more Omega 3, 120.4 times more Omega 6 and 1.4 times more Protein than Raw Red Kidney Beans.
